M Query: Add list of months between dates
I'm trying to add rows for each month between two dates. I found some example code on the forums and tried to adapt it for my purposes, but it isn't working properly. I'm adding a custom column named "DateRange" and using the following code.
Table.AddColumn(#"Expanded people", "DateRange", (earlier) => List.Generate(
() => [EffortDate = earlier[award_begin_date], Counter = earlier[Months]],
each [EffortDate] <= earlier[award_end_date],
each [EffortDate = Date.AddMonths(earlier[award_begin_date],[Counter]),
Counter = [Counter] + earlier[Months]],
each [EffortDate]),
type {date})
It says there are no syntax errors. I expand the resulting Table column and then when I try to expand the resulting List column into new rows, I just get errors. Any help would be appreciated!
Hi, Anonymous , don't bother to use List.Generate(); List.Accumulate() would come in handy in your senario. You might want to try,
let Source = Table.FromRows(Json.Document(Binary.Decompress(Binary.FromText("i45WMlTSUTLRN9Q3MjC0BDKN9Y1BbCMDpVidaCUjoIgZRNICyDRFSMYCAA==", BinaryEncoding.Base64), Compression.Deflate)), let _t = ((type nullable text) meta [Serialized.Text = true]) in type table [ID = _t, award_begin_date = _t, award_end_date = _t]), #"Changed Type" = Table.TransformColumnTypes(Source,{{"ID", Int64.Type}, {"award_begin_date", type date}, {"award_end_date", type date}}), #"Added Custom" = Table.AddColumn( #"Changed Type", "col", each let begin = Date.StartOfMonth([award_begin_date]) in List.Accumulate( {0..(Date.Year([award_end_date])-Date.Year([award_begin_date]))*12+(Date.Month([award_end_date])-Date.Month([award_begin_date]))}, {}, (s,c) => s&{Date.AddMonths(begin,c)} ) ), #"Expanded col" = Table.ExpandListColumn(#"Added Custom", "col") in #"Expanded col"
